Overview

Pru p 3-specific CD4+ T-cell receptors are the primary mediators of the cellular immune response to Pru p 3, the major allergen in peach (Prunus persica). These receptors, located on the surface of CD4+ T helper cells, recognize specific peptide fragments of the Pru p 3 protein presented by Major Histocompatibility Complex (MHC) class II molecules. In allergic individuals, the interaction between these TCRs and Pru p 3 epitopes typically triggers a Th2-biased immune response, leading to the production of allergen-specific IgE and subsequent allergic inflammation. Pru p 3 is a non-specific lipid transfer protein (nsLTP) known for its high stability and potential to cause severe systemic reactions, including anaphylaxis. Targeting these TCRs through allergen-specific immunotherapy (AIT) aims to induce immune tolerance by promoting the expansion of regulatory T cells or shifting the cytokine profile toward a Th1-type response. Understanding the specific TCR repertoire and the dominant epitopes, such as Pru p 3 11-25 and 57-71, is crucial for developing safer and more effective peptide-based vaccines for peach allergy.

Mechanism of action

Induction of peripheral T-cell tolerance, anergy, or immune deviation from a Th2-dominated response to a Th1 or regulatory T-cell (Treg) response through repeated exposure to specific Pru p 3 epitopes.
